Social media trends can really change how new music styles develop in several ways:
Viral Challenges: Apps like TikTok can make songs really popular fast. For example, Lil Nas X's song “Old Town Road” became a huge hit when people shared it in funny videos and memes.
Genre Blending: Musicians like to mix different music styles because of what's trending. This can create new types of music. A good example is when rappers add country sounds to their songs.
Global Influences: Social media brings together different cultures. This helps music styles like K-pop become popular all around the world very quickly.
